The Hotshot Fritz defends Delray Beach title
Taylor “The Hotshot” Fritz successfully defended his title at the Delray Beach Open, beating Tommy Paul 6-2, 6-3 in the final.
The American won the crown last year – again as top seed – and has now won his last six ATP Tour finals, seventh overall.
Fritz is the second man in tournament history to win consecutive titles, joining Jason Stoltenberg, who won in 1996 and 1997.
In 2023, The Hotshot also reached the final of UTS Los Angeles, going two quarters up but ultimately losing 11-16, 7-20, 12-11, 16-9, 2-0 in sudden death to Wu “The Great Wall” Yibing.
